Why are certain goods regulated by the principle of mutual recognition?

Explanation:
The principle of mutual recognition is established to ensure that goods and services which are legally produced or marketed in one EU member state can be sold in another member state without facing additional checks or barriers, provided they meet the necessary safety and compliance standards. This approach fosters a smooth functioning of the internal market by allowing products that comply with the regulations of one country to be accepted in others, promoting cross-border trade and consumer protection. It plays a vital role in enhancing market efficiency and consumer trust since consumers can be assured that products available on the market are safe and meet specific standards, regardless of where they are produced within the EU. Therefore, the principle underlines the importance of safety and compliance across borders, which is essential for maintaining a high standard of quality and safety for consumers in the European Union.
